Materials and Manufacturing Process
LPG and CNG diaphragms must withstand high pressures, temperature fluctuations, and chemical exposure from gases. Common materials include nitrile, fluorocarbon, EPDM, and silicone, each selected for specific application requirements. Nitrile is resistant to oils and hydrocarbons, while fluorocarbon handles extreme temperatures and chemical exposure effectively. EPDM offers excellent water and weather resistance, and silicone remains flexible in varying thermal conditions. Manufacturers in China utilize precision molding, heat curing, and reinforcement methods to produce uniform, high-strength diaphragms. Rigorous testing ensures tensile strength, leak prevention, and durability under cyclic loading. Advanced quality control aligns with ISO and other international standards, guaranteeing consistent performance. Functional Design and Performance
The design of LPG and CNG diaphragms emphasizes precise motion and leak-free operation. Reinforced layers, tailored thickness, and optimized geometry allow the diaphragm to flex without overstretching. These features reduce friction and wear while ensuring accurate pressure regulation. Chinese suppliers often simulate operational environments to test diaphragms under real-world conditions, including pressure changes and chemical exposure. This validation ensures diaphragms remain functional under repeated cycles and extreme conditions. Correct diaphragm design distributes stress evenly, preventing localized failure and extending service life. Maintenance and Longevity
Proper installation and periodic inspection are key to extending diaphragm lifespan. Checking for wear, deformation, or chemical degradation ensures continued safe operation. Operating within recommended pressure and temperature ranges prevents premature failure. Replacement following supplier specifications maintains consistent performance and safety.
